Readout of the President's Call with President-elect Humala of Peru

Earlier this afternoon, President Obama called Ollanta Humala, President-elect of Peru, to congratulate him on his victory in the June 5 election.   President Obama commended the people of Peru for their commitment to democracy.  Noting the strong historic ties between the United States and Peru, the President underscored his interest in strengthening our bilateral partnership to continue work on a wide range of topics, including effective democratic governance, respect for shared values, broad-based economic growth and prosperity, citizen security, and other regional and global issues of mutual interest.
